Questions & Answers

Q: What inspired Howard Schultz to transform Starbucks from a coffee bean retailer to a café chain?

Howard Schultz was inspired by his trip to Italy, where he experienced the vibrant atmosphere of Italian coffee bars, which emphasized community and social interaction. This inspired him to introduce a similar café culture in the United States, aiming to provide a “third place” for people to gather, relax, and enjoy high-quality coffee.

Q: How did Starbucks' expansion strategy contribute to its decline in the 2000s?

Starbucks prioritized rapid growth and market saturation, leading to the opening of numerous stores in close proximity, resulting in brand fatigue among consumers. As the iconic mermaid logo became ubiquitous, customers perceived Starbucks as being less special, which diluted the experience and led to declining customer loyalty and satisfaction.

Q: What major changes did Howard Schultz implement upon returning as CEO of Starbucks in 2008?

Upon his return, Schultz emphasized restoring the quality of the coffee experience by reinstating traditional coffee machines and retraining baristas. He also decided to reduce the variety of products offered in stores, focusing on core coffee offerings to enhance customer experience and align with Starbucks' brand values.

Q: Why did Starbucks face challenges in the Chinese market?

Starbucks struggled to resonate with Chinese consumers due to cultural misunderstandings and a strong preference for tea. Initial efforts were perceived as imposing Western values without adapting to local tastes. A strategic shift towards local engagement and tailored coffee experiences was necessary for improving brand perception in China.

Summary & Key Takeaways

  • Starbucks began as a modest coffee roaster in Seattle in 1971, evolving into a global coffee empire under Howard Schultz's ambitious leadership that redefined consumer coffee experiences.

  • However, aggressive expansion strategies and prioritizing growth over brand values led to a perceived loss of its unique coffee culture and consumer sentiment, resulting in declining sales and brand loyalty.

  • Howard Schultz's return as CEO in 2008 aimed to reclaim Starbucks' original identity, focusing on quality coffee and customer experience, while adapting to local markets, especially in Asia.
